Earl L Lawson 1922 - 1976

Earl L Lawson of Bloomington, Monroe County, Indiana was born on October 5, 1922, and died at age 53 years old in April 1976.

Did you know?
In 1922, in the year that Earl L Lawson was born, the Reparations Commission assessed German liability for World War 1 at 132 billion gold marks (over $32 billion U.S. dollars at the time). This led to hyperinflation in Germany and created the political and social atmosphere in which Hitler was able to rise to power.
